我已经为我现有的php页面创建了一个React App,它使用session来存储userid
。会话由普通的.php登录页面设置,但是当我尝试调用访问会话的API调用时,它似乎没有设置。
反应应用程序是否在其自己的“环境”中,是否需要使用令牌?
我很困惑..
编辑:通过这个questin从一个不同的线程解决它: https://stackoverflow.com/a/44111668/3010171
答案 0 :(得分:0)
这是两件不同的事情。 PHP在服务器端工作,React在客户端工作。
如您所见,WebServer将HTML内容返回给客户端。 ReactJS在Web浏览器中工作。如果您想从服务器接收一些数据,可以看到本教程https://www.youtube.com/watch?v=Y4NHqDp88lA
答案 1 :(得分:0)
从另一个线程通过以下问题解决了该问题: https://stackoverflow.com/a/44111668/3010171
包括
credentials: 'same-origin'
在请求的标题中。